Biography

Mogens Davidsen is an Associate Professor Emeritus at the University of Southern Denmark. He has made significant contributions to the field of research with a focus on providing insights into several critical areas such as new materialism and vitality, particularly in relation to public and private discourse. His work often involves analyzing media contributions, which underline the need for effective communication in literary studies. Davidsen's expertise also encompasses a blend of theoretical frameworks applied to understanding social narratives and their implications for contemporary issues.
